Thrombo-inflammatory endothelial signatures in <i>JAK2</i> -mutated myeloproliferative neoplasms

2026-02-18

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background</h4> Classical my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PN)—essential thrombocythemia, polycythemia vera, and primary myelofibrosis—are characterized by clonal hematopoiesis, overproduction of mature blood cells, and a high burden of thromboembolic events. Although thrombosis is the leading cause of morbidity and mortality in MPN, the contribution of the vascular endothelium remains incompletely defined. We...
